AI Transparency Report

The Kellner Foundation demonstrates a mixed financial picture. While the organization consistently maintains a healthy asset base, averaging over $2.5 million in recent years, its revenue generation has been highly volatile, including significant negative revenue in 2015 and 2013. This volatility makes long-term financial planning and consistent program delivery challenging. The foundation's expenses have also fluctuated considerably, from a low of $48,243 in 2020 to a high of $656,281 in 2013. Spending efficiency is difficult to fully assess without a detailed breakdown of program, administrative, and fundraising expenses, which are not provided in the summary data. However, the consistent reporting of 0% officer compensation across all filings suggests a commitment to minimizing overhead in that specific area. The foundation's liabilities have remained consistently low, often reported as $1 or $0, indicating good financial management regarding debt. In terms of transparency, the consistent filing of IRS Form 990s over a decade is a positive indicator. The absence of officer compensation is also a transparent practice. However, without more granular expense data, a complete picture of how funds are allocated to programs versus other costs remains somewhat opaque. The significant fluctuations in revenue and expenses warrant closer examination to understand the underlying operational dynamics.
